About agriculture in Miliroc

Situated in the Bicol Region, Miliroc is defined by the lush, verdant landscapes characteristic of this part of the Philippines. The area features rolling hills and fertile plains nourished by volcanic soil, with a climate that remains tropical and humid throughout the year. The proximity to mountains and the coast creates a scenic, rural backdrop where nature dictates the rhythm of daily life.

The agricultural landscape around Miliroc is heavily influenced by the region's productive volcanic soil. Key crops include coconut plantations, abaca, and rice, which dominate the local farming efforts. Small-scale livestock farming, including poultry and swine, also plays a crucial role in the local food economy, supporting the sustainable practices typical of the Bicol province.

For agricultural workers and agronomists, Miliroc offers opportunities linked primarily to the seasonal harvest cycles of rice and coconuts. The demand for labor intensifies during planting and harvesting periods, making it essential to plan work accordingly. Those visiting should be prepared for a humid environment and recognize that the local farming community thrives on traditional methods combined with increasing interest in modern sustainable techniques.
